The following reviews from the previous edition: (Berek and Novak's Gynecology, 14th Edition) "In comparing this book to Stenchever's Comprehensive Gynecology, 4th edition (Mosby, 2001), which has been touted by some as the "Bible" of gynecology for residents, Berek and Novak's seems to appeal to a wider range of training levels and offers a wider range of references (over 300 per chapter versus fewer than 50), as well as broader and more numerous author contributions. The 14th edition is structurally sound, comprehensive, and accessible." - Doody's Book Reviews - Weighted Numerical Score: 95 - 4 Stars! (February 2007) Andrea R. Hagemann, M.D.(Washington University School of Medicine) " Berek and Novak's Gynecology still remains an excellent choice as a gynecology text or reference book, due to the expertise of the authors and editor." - JAMA. 2007;297:1602-1603 , The following reviews from the previous edition: (Berek and Novak's Gynecology, 14th Edition) "In comparing this book to Stenchever's Comprehensive Gynecology, 4th edition (Mosby, 2001), which has been touted by some as the "Bible" of gynecology for residents, Berek and Novak's seems to appeal to a wider range of training levels and offers a wider range of references (over 300 per chapter versus fewer than 50), as well as broader and more numerous author contributions.
